Illyrian thistle

Onopordum illyricum

Illyrian thistle is an erect annual or biennial herb growing to a height of 2 m. Stems are erect, woolly and whitish in colour. They are very prominently winged, spiny and branched near the top. Illyrian thistle leaves are densely woolly and a whitish colour. They have deep lobes, coarse teeth, and spines on the margins. Leaf bases continue down the stems as wings. Rosette leaves can grow to 30 cm long. Illyrian thistle has purple florets with globular heads that grow to 8 cm in diameter, including numerous bracts. Bracts are large, broad, purple and end in sharp yellow spines with outer bracts reflexed.
